fre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

商店銷售網(wǎng)站的設(shè)計與實現(xiàn)(編輯修改稿)

2025-07-27 13:15 本頁面
 

【文章內(nèi)容簡介】 發(fā)的靈魂和基礎(chǔ),是整個系統(tǒng)成功的關(guān)鍵所在,是開發(fā)高品質(zhì)應(yīng)用的前提,鑒于數(shù)據(jù)庫設(shè)計的重要性,做如下約定:設(shè)計過程應(yīng)按照概念模型設(shè)計—關(guān)系模型設(shè)計—物理數(shù)據(jù)庫設(shè)計的步驟進(jìn)行。 關(guān)系模式設(shè)計由系統(tǒng)的概念模型導(dǎo)出關(guān)系模式。主要原則及實現(xiàn)方法如下:(1)一個實體型轉(zhuǎn)換為一個關(guān)系模式,實體的屬性就是關(guān)系的屬性,實體的鍵就是關(guān)系的鍵。(2)一個是實體的聯(lián)系轉(zhuǎn)換為關(guān)系模式時,應(yīng)首先確定該聯(lián)系的類型,在確定相應(yīng)的鍵。(3)進(jìn)行規(guī)范化處理,求出關(guān)系模式中的最小依賴集,并依據(jù)規(guī)范化理論,將關(guān)系模式規(guī)范到三范式。依據(jù)上述原則,得出《超市進(jìn)銷存系統(tǒng)》的關(guān)系模式:(1) 訂單(訂單編號, 日期,商品名稱,商品數(shù)量,商品單價,金額)(2) 快遞名單(快遞編號,商品名稱,數(shù)量,預(yù)計到達(dá)時間)(3) 收貨確認(rèn)(訂單編號,日期,是否收貨,是否付款)(4) 訂單取消(訂單編號,日期,退貨原因)(5) 完成訂單(訂單編號,日期,是否付款)(6) 商品交易記錄(訂單編號,日期,商品名稱,商品數(shù)量,商品單價,金額,是否付款,備注。)(7) 訂單金額(訂單編號,商品名稱,商品數(shù)量,商品單價,金額)(8) 訂單時間(訂單編號, 日期)(9) 商品價格(商品名稱,商品單價) (10)發(fā)貨名單(訂單編號,商品名稱)(11)庫存(訂單編號,是否有庫存) 物理結(jié)構(gòu)設(shè)計物理結(jié)構(gòu)設(shè)計是物理數(shù)據(jù)庫的具體表現(xiàn),主要規(guī)定各關(guān)系的名稱、各列的數(shù)據(jù)類型、長度、小數(shù)位、完整性約束等。本系統(tǒng)數(shù)據(jù)庫物理結(jié)構(gòu)設(shè)計見表41至411。表41訂單表列含義列標(biāo)示類型長度完整性約束訂單編號日期商品名稱商品數(shù)量商品單價金額dmrqspmcspslspdgjechardate charnumbnumbnumb88308810數(shù)字字符日期型數(shù)據(jù)字符型數(shù)據(jù)數(shù)值數(shù)值(兩位小數(shù))數(shù)值(兩位小數(shù))表42快遞名單列含義列標(biāo)示類型長度完整性約束快遞編號dmchar10數(shù)字字符商品名稱spmcchar30字符型數(shù)據(jù)數(shù)量spslnumb8數(shù)值預(yù)計到達(dá)時間yjddsjdate6日期型數(shù)據(jù)表43收貨確認(rèn)表列含義列標(biāo)示類型長度完整性約束訂單編號dmchar8數(shù)字字符日期rqdate8日期型數(shù)據(jù)是否收貨sfshcharTrue_False字符型數(shù)據(jù)是否付款sffkcharTrue_False字符型數(shù)據(jù)表44訂單取消表列含義列標(biāo)示類型長度完整性約束訂單編號dmchar8數(shù)字字符日期rqdate8日期型數(shù)據(jù)退貨原因thyychar80字符型數(shù)據(jù)表45完成訂單表列含義列標(biāo)示類型長度完整性約束訂單編號dmchar5數(shù)字字符日期是否付款rqsffkDatechar8True_False日期型數(shù)據(jù)字符型數(shù)據(jù)表46商品交易記錄表列含義列標(biāo)示類型長度完整性約束入庫單編號dmchar8數(shù)字字符日期rqdate8日期型數(shù)據(jù)商品名稱spmcchar30字符型數(shù)據(jù)商品數(shù)量spslnumb8數(shù)值商品單價spdjnumb8數(shù)值金額jenumb10數(shù)值是否付款sffkcharTrue_False字符型數(shù)據(jù)備注bzchar30字符型數(shù)據(jù)表47訂單金額表列含義列標(biāo)示類型長度完整性約束訂單編號Dmchar8數(shù)字字符商品名稱Spmcchar30字符型數(shù)據(jù)商品數(shù)量Spslnumb8數(shù)值商品單價Spdjnumb8數(shù)值金額Jenumb10數(shù)值表48訂單時間表列含義列標(biāo)示類型長度完整性約束訂單編號Ddbhchar8數(shù)字字符日期Rqdate8日期型數(shù)據(jù)表49商品價格表列含義列標(biāo)示類型長度完整性約束商品名稱Spmcchar30字符型數(shù)據(jù)商品單價Spdjnumb8數(shù)值表410發(fā)貨名單表列含義列標(biāo)示類型長度完整性約束訂單編號Ddbhchar8數(shù)字字符商品名稱Spmcchar30字符型數(shù)據(jù)表411庫存表列含義列標(biāo)示類型長度完整性約束訂單編號DdbhChar8數(shù)字字符是否有庫存SfyhccharTrue_False字符型數(shù)據(jù)UML是用來對軟件密集系統(tǒng)進(jìn)行可視化建模的一種語言,是在開發(fā)階段,說明,可視化,構(gòu)建和書寫一個面向?qū)ο筌浖芗到y(tǒng)的制品的開放方法。 狀態(tài)圖狀態(tài)圖主要用來描述對象、子系統(tǒng)、系統(tǒng)的生命周期。通過狀態(tài)圖可以表現(xiàn)系統(tǒng)中一個對象所具有的各種狀態(tài)和這個對象從一種狀態(tài)到另一種狀態(tài)的轉(zhuǎn)換(遷移),以及影響對象這些狀態(tài)的事件(如收到消息、時間已到、報錯、條件為真)等。它主要描述某個對象從一個狀態(tài)到另一個狀態(tài)變化遷移的控制流。圖41 狀態(tài)圖 動態(tài)圖動態(tài)圖主要用來描述用例要求所要進(jìn)行的活動,以及活動間的約束關(guān)系,有利于識別并行活動。能夠演示出系統(tǒng)中哪些地方存在功能,以及這些功能和系統(tǒng)中其他組件的功能如何共同滿足前面使用用例圖建模的商務(wù)需求。圖42動態(tài)圖 HIPO圖HIPO圖是用來表示軟件系統(tǒng)結(jié)構(gòu)的工具。它既可以描述軟件總的模塊層次結(jié)構(gòu)H圖(層次圖),又可以描述每個模塊輸入/輸出數(shù)據(jù)、處理功能及模塊調(diào)用的詳細(xì)情況IPO圖。HIPO圖以模塊分解的層次性以及模塊內(nèi)部輸入、處理、輸出三大基本部分為基礎(chǔ)建立的。它是表示軟件系統(tǒng)結(jié)構(gòu)的工具。HIPO圖以模塊分解的層次性以及模塊內(nèi)部輸入、處理、輸出三大基本部分為基礎(chǔ)建立的。發(fā)貨通知發(fā)貨管理退貨審核退貨管理訂單管理統(tǒng)計交易記錄交易記錄管理提交交易記錄系統(tǒng)管理數(shù)據(jù)維護(hù)系統(tǒng)維護(hù)代碼維護(hù)圖43 HIPO圖模塊設(shè)計是針對系統(tǒng)結(jié)構(gòu)圖中的每個模塊定義其外部及內(nèi)部特性的工作,即模塊說明。其主要目的是為程序員要完成每個模塊的具體功能提供依據(jù)。依據(jù)是輸入、處理、輸出的詳細(xì)描述。模塊IPO圖 第1號系統(tǒng)名稱:訂單管理 子系統(tǒng)名稱:發(fā)貨管理模塊名稱:發(fā)貨通知 模塊代碼:CJP11調(diào)用模塊:無 被調(diào)用模塊:發(fā)貨管理輸入:發(fā)貨名單 輸出:快遞名單處理:“發(fā)貨名單”和“快遞名單”。 “發(fā)貨名單”的第一個記錄開始循環(huán),將該記錄寫入并存儲進(jìn)”快遞名單”中,然后繼續(xù)記錄下一個記錄,直到最后。 “發(fā)貨名單”和“快遞名單”。模塊IPO圖 第2號系統(tǒng)名稱:訂單管理 子系統(tǒng)名稱:退貨管理模塊名稱:退貨審核 模塊代碼:CJP21調(diào)用模塊:無 被調(diào)用模塊:退貨管理輸入:收貨確認(rèn)表 輸出:訂單取消表處理:“收貨確認(rèn)表”和“訂單取消表”。 “收貨確認(rèn)表”的第一個記錄開始循環(huán)判斷,將審核通過的記錄寫入并存儲到“訂單取消表”中,直到最后。 “收貨確認(rèn)表”和“訂單取消表”。模塊IPO圖 第3號系統(tǒng)名稱:訂單管理 子系統(tǒng)名稱:交易記錄管理模塊名稱:統(tǒng)計交易記錄 模塊代碼:CJP31調(diào)用模塊:無 被調(diào)用模塊:交易記錄管理輸入:完成訂單表 輸出:商品交易記錄庫處理:“完成訂單表”和“商品交易記錄庫”。 “完成訂單表”的第一個記錄開始循環(huán)判斷,將審核通過的記錄寫入并存儲到“商品交易記錄庫”中,直到最后。 “完成訂單表”和“商品交易記錄庫”。 模塊IPO圖 第4號系統(tǒng)名稱:訂單管理 子系統(tǒng)名稱:交易記錄管理模塊名稱:提交交易記錄 模塊代碼:CJP32調(diào)用模塊:無 被調(diào)用模塊:交易記錄管理輸入:商品交易記錄庫 輸出:交易記錄表處理:“商品交易記錄庫”和“交易記錄表”。 “商品交易記錄庫”的第一個記錄開始循環(huán)判斷,將審核通過的記錄寫入并存儲到“交易記錄表”中,直到最后。 “商品交易記錄庫”和“交易記錄表”。 輸入輸出設(shè)計 輸入設(shè)計輸入設(shè)計擔(dān)負(fù)著將系統(tǒng)外的數(shù)據(jù)以一定的格式送入計算機(jī),輸入設(shè)計的一條重要原則是確保系統(tǒng)輸入的信息準(zhǔn)確無誤。本系統(tǒng)輸入設(shè)計見表414至434。表4 12訂貨單輸入設(shè)計 orders of design輸入名稱:訂貨單 輸入設(shè)備和介質(zhì):鍵盤輸入源:顧客 輸入時間和頻率:隨機(jī)輸入信息量: 共享范圍:本系統(tǒng)使用表413訂貨單輸入格式及內(nèi)容 orders of the format and content數(shù)據(jù)項名稱類型實際長度備注購物單編號char8系統(tǒng)自動填寫日期date8系統(tǒng)自動檢驗業(yè)務(wù)員代碼char3系統(tǒng)自動選擇商品代碼char5系統(tǒng)自動檢驗商品數(shù)量numb50商品單價numb60表414商品入庫單輸入設(shè)計 Commodity storage lists of design輸入名稱:商品入庫單 輸入設(shè)備和介質(zhì):鍵盤輸入源:保管員 輸入時間和頻率:隨機(jī)輸入信息量: 共享范圍:本系統(tǒng)使用表415商品入庫單輸入格式及內(nèi)容 format and content of storage lists數(shù)據(jù)項名稱類型實際長度備注入庫單編號char8手工輸入日期date8系統(tǒng)自動檢驗業(yè)務(wù)員代碼char3列表選擇輸入倉庫代碼char1列表選擇輸入商品代碼char5列表選擇輸入商品數(shù)量numb50是否付款Char2列表選擇輸入是否記賬Char2列表選擇輸入預(yù)付比例Numb30,1折扣Numb30,1表416商品出庫單輸入設(shè)計 warehouse remove list of design輸入名稱:商品出庫單 輸入設(shè)備和介質(zhì):鍵盤輸入源:發(fā)貨員 輸入時間和頻率:隨機(jī)輸入信息量: 共享范圍:本系統(tǒng)使用表417商品出庫單輸入格式及內(nèi)容 format and content of warehouse remove list數(shù)據(jù)項名稱類型實際長度備注出庫單編號char8手工輸入日期date8系統(tǒng)自動檢驗業(yè)務(wù)員代碼char3列表選擇輸入倉庫代碼char1列表選擇輸入商品代碼char5列表選擇輸入商品數(shù)量numb50表418商品銷售單輸入設(shè)計 modity Sales list of design輸入名稱:商品銷售單 輸入設(shè)備和介質(zhì):鍵盤輸入源:營業(yè)員
點擊復(fù)制文檔內(nèi)容
高考資料相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1